There are 9 ways to get from Venice to Milany by train, car, bus, plane, taxi, or shuttle
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train, drive
best- Take the train from Venezia S. Lucia to Milano Centraletrain Fr
- Take the train from Milano Centrale to Lyon Part Dieutrain Fr
- Take the train from Lyon Part Dieu to Gironatrain
- Drive from Mercat Municipal to Milanycar
15h 37m€129–312Fly from Venice Marco Polo Airport, train, taxi
cheapest- Fly from Venice Marco Polo Airport (VCE) to Barcelona–El Prat Airport (BCN)plane VCE - BCN
- Take the train from El Prat Aeroport to Les Franqueses-Granollers Nordtrain
- Take the train from La Garriga to La Farga De Bebiétrain
- Take the taxi from La Farga De Bebié to Milanytaxi
9h 29m€111–236Bus via Perpignan
- Take the bus from Venice to Perpignanbus
- Take the bus from PERPIGNAN, Gare Routiere, Bd Saint-Assiscle, k/SNCF to Girona, Estació d'Autobusosbus
- Take the bus from Girona, Estació d'Autobusos to Vallfogona de Ripollèsbus
21h 35m€154–244Drive 1,121.3 km
- Drive from Venice to Milanycar 1,121.3 km
13h 13m€173–249Bus
- Take the bus from Padova to Girona, Estació d'Autobusosbus
- Take the bus from Girona, Estació d'Autobusos to Sant Joan de les Abadessesbus Girona-Olot-Ripoll Per St. Joan de Les Abadesses
21h 44m€122–218Train to Bologna Guglielmo Marconi Airport, fly, train
- Take the train from Venezia S. Lucia to Bologna Centraletrain
- Fly from Bologna Guglielmo Marconi Airport (BLQ) to Barcelona–El Prat Airport (BCN)plane BLQ - BCN
- Take the train from El Prat Aeroport to Les Franqueses-Granollers Nordtrain
- Take the train from La Garriga to La Farga De Bebiétrain
10h 43m€126–294Train to Verona Villafranca Airport, fly, train
- Take the train from Venezia S. Lucia to Verona Porta Nuovatrain
- Fly from Verona Villafranca Airport (VRN) to Barcelona–El Prat Airport (BCN)plane VRN - BCN
- Take the train from El Prat Aeroport to Les Franqueses-Granollers Nordtrain
- Take the train from La Garriga to La Farga De Bebiétrain
10h 39m€126–367Train to Florence Peretola Airport, fly, train
- Take the train from Venezia S. Lucia to Firenze S.M.N.train
- Fly from Florence Peretola Airport (FLR) to Barcelona–El Prat Airport (BCN)plane FLR - BCN
- Take the train from El Prat Aeroport to Les Franqueses-Granollers Nordtrain
- Take the train from La Garriga to La Farga De Bebiétrain
11h 35m€140–317Shuttle to Il Caravaggio International Airport, fly, train
- Take a shuttle bus from Padova to Orio al Serio Airport
- Fly from Il Caravaggio International Airport (BGY) to Barcelona–El Prat Airport (BCN)plane BGY - BCN
- Take the train from El Prat Aeroport to Les Franqueses-Granollers Nordtrain
- Take the train from La Garriga to La Farga De Bebiétrain
12h 11m€155–593
Venice Marco Polo Airport (VCE) to Barcelona–El Prat Airport (BCN) flights
Questions & Answers
The cheapest way to get from Venice to Milany is to fly and train and taxi which costs €110 - €240 and takes 9h 29m.
The fastest way to get from Venice to Milany is to fly and train and taxi which takes 9h 29m and costs €110 - €240.
The distance between Venice and Milany is 1362 km. The road distance is 1121.3 km.
The best way to get from Venice to Milany without a car is to bus via Perpignan which takes 21h 35m and costs €150 - €250.
It takes approximately 15h 37m to get from Venice to Milany, including transfers.
Yes, the driving distance between Venice to Milany is 1121 km. It takes approximately 13h 13m to drive from Venice to Milany.
There are 621+ hotels available in Milany.
What companies run services between Venice, Italy and Milany, Spain?
You can take a bus from Venice to Milany via PERPIGNAN, Gare Routiere, Bd Saint-Assiscle, k/SNCF, Girona, Estació d'Autobusos, and Vallfogona de Ripollès in around 21h 35m.
- Website
- ryanair.com
Flights from Venice Marco Polo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 55m
- When
- Monday, Tuesday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- €24–110
Flights from Bologna Guglielmo Marconi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 50m
- When
- Every day
- Estimated price
- €30–140
Flights from Il Caravaggio International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 45m
- When
- Every day
- Estimated price
- €30–130
- Website
- vueling.com
Flights from Venice Marco Polo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 53m
- When
- Every day
- Estimated price
- €20–120
Flights from Bologna Guglielmo Marconi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 45m
- When
- Every day
- Estimated price
- €23–110
Flights from Florence Peretola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 41m
- When
- Every day
- Estimated price
- €30–140
- Website
- swiss.com
Flights from Venice Marco Polo Airport to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 5m
- When
- Every day
- Estimated price
- €60–250
Flights from Florence Peretola Airport to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 15m
- When
- Every day
- Estimated price
- €95–240
- Website
- ita-airways.com
Flights from Florence Peretola Airport to Barcelona–El Prat Airport via Rome
- Ave. Duration
- 4h 13m
- When
- Every day
- Estimated price
- €60–180
- Website
- volotea.com
Flights from Verona Villafranca Airport to Barcelona–El Prat Airport
- Ave. Duration
- 1h 40m
- When
- Monday, Wednesday, Friday, and Sunday
- Estimated price
- €28–120
Flights from Verona Villafranca Airport to Barcelona–El Prat Airport via Olbia
- Ave. Duration
- 3h 40m
- When
- Thursday
- Estimated price
- €28–120
- Website
- flyulendo.com
Flights from Venice Marco Polo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h
- When
- Monday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- €22–95
- Phone
- +39 06 68475475
- Website
- trenitalia.com
Train from Venezia S. Lucia to Milano Centrale
- Ave. Duration
- 2h 27m
- Frequency
- Hourly
- Estimated price
- €19–55
- Schedules at
- trenitalia.com
Train from Venezia S. Lucia to Bologna Centrale
- Ave. Duration
- 1h 33m
- Frequency
- Hourly
- Estimated price
- €13–40
- Schedules at
- trenitalia.com
Train from Venezia S. Lucia to Verona Porta Nuova
- Ave. Duration
- 1h 12m
- Frequency
- Hourly
- Estimated price
- €10–29
- Schedules at
- trenitalia.com
Train from Venezia S. Lucia to Firenze S.M.N.
- Ave. Duration
- 2h 13m
- Frequency
- Hourly
- Estimated price
- €22–60
- Schedules at
- trenitalia.com
- Phone
- +39 06 68475475
- ufficiogruppi@trenitalia.it
- Website
- trenitalia.com
Train from Venezia S. Lucia to Milano Centrale
- Ave. Duration
- 2h 37m
- Frequency
- Twice daily
- Estimated price
- €60–110
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- €75–110
- 2nd Class
- €60–80
Train from Venezia S. Lucia to Verona Porta Nuova
- Ave. Duration
- 1h 12m
- Frequency
- Twice daily
- Estimated price
- €30–75
- Website
- https://www.trenitalia.com/en.html
- 1st Class
- €50–75
- 2nd Class
- €30–45
- Phone
- +39.06.5210550
- Website
- trenitalia.com
Train from Milano Centrale to Lyon Part Dieu
- Ave. Duration
- 4h 39m
- Frequency
- Twice daily
- Estimated price
- €50–120
- Website
- https://www.trenitalia.com/en.html
Train from Venezia S. Lucia to Bologna Centrale
- Ave. Duration
- 2h 15m
- Frequency
- Hourly
- Estimated price
- €15
- Website
- https://www.trenitalia.com/en.html
Train from Venezia S. Lucia to Verona Porta Nuova
- Ave. Duration
- 1h 28m
- Frequency
- Hourly
- Estimated price
- €10–11
- Website
- https://www.trenitalia.com/en.html
Rome2Rio's guide to Renfe Viajeros
Contact Details
- Phone
- +34 91 232 03 20
- Website
- renfe.com
Train from Lyon Part Dieu to Girona
- Ave. Duration
- 4h 3m
- Frequency
- Once daily
- Estimated price
- €45–65
- Website
- https://www.renfe.com/es/en
- Phone
- +34 900 41 00 41
- Website
- rodalies.gencat.cat
Train from El Prat Aeroport to Les Franqueses-Granollers Nord
- Ave. Duration
- 1h 2m
- Frequency
- Hourly
- Estimated price
- €5–6
- Website
- https://rodalies.gencat.cat/en/inici/index.html
Train from La Garriga to La Farga De Bebié
- Ave. Duration
- 59 min
- Frequency
- Hourly
- Estimated price
- €4–7
- Website
- https://rodalies.gencat.cat/en/inici/index.html
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Venice to Perpignan
- Ave. Duration
- 15h 15m
- Frequency
- Once daily
- Estimated price
- €80–120
- Website
- https://www.flixbus.co.uk
- Phone
- +34 910 207 007
- alsa@alsa.es
- Website
- alsa.com
Bus from PERPIGNAN, Gare Routiere, Bd Saint-Assiscle, k/SNCF to Girona, Estació d'Autobusos
- Ave. Duration
- 1h 15m
- Frequency
- Once daily
- Estimated price
- €17–60
- Website
- https://www.alsa.com/en/
- Phone
- +34 972 20 48 68
- info@teisa-bus.com
- Website
- teisa-bus.com
Bus from Girona, Estació d'Autobusos to Vallfogona de Ripollès
- Ave. Duration
- 2h 5m
- Frequency
- 4 times a week
- Estimated price
- €15–22
- Website
- https://www.teisa-bus.com/en/index.html
Bus from Girona, Estació d'Autobusos to Sant Joan de les Abadesses
- Ave. Duration
- 2h 5m
- Frequency
- Every 3 hours
- Estimated price
- €12–21
- Website
- https://www.teisa-bus.com/en/index.html
- Phone
- +4-0263-21.55.00
- Website
- tabitatour.ro
Bus from Padova to Girona, Estació d'Autobusos
- Ave. Duration
- 15h 50m
- Frequency
- Once a week
- Estimated price
- €55–75
- Schedules at
- tabitatour.ro
- Phone
- +386 1 320 4530
- info@goopti.com
- Website
- goopti.com
Shuttle from Padova to Orio al Serio Airport
- Ave. Duration
- 2h 12m
- Frequency
- On demand
- Estimated price
- €35–280
- Website
- https://www.goopti.com/en/
- Shared
- €35–39
- Private
- €150–280
- Ave. Duration
- 1h 21m
- Estimated price
- €70–90
Taxi Vic Eras
- Phone
- +34 609 39 09 80
Taxi Pous
- Phone
- +34 695 598 469
- Website
- taxipous.com
Associació Taxi Vic
- Phone
- +34 938 855 000
- Website
- taxisvic.com
Taxis Olot 24h Jordi
- Phone
- +34 635 95 37 08
- Website
- taxisolot24h.com
Taxis Olot
- Phone
- +34 682 63 94 35
Taxis Berga
- Phone
- +34 938 21 11 11
- Website
- taxisberga.net
Taxi Daniel Bonet
- Phone
- +34 606 69 12 72
Want to know more about travelling around Spain
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Italy Travel Guides
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Train travel in Spain: A guide to Renfe
Read the travel guide





































